Output 4fa5707226f5b68109d4eead4ad725d21f549a87a0bb9fc661e7ae45c259887c: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e44db5fbf92fdb67f529b9bb6dea9f292036bd6 OP_EQUAL
address
3DCfYyfNQwemRqKvTNhBTvmAwr3sVWdwDM
transaction
4fa5707226f5b68109d4eead4ad725d21f549a87a0bb9fc661e7ae45c259887c
confirmations
454470
spent
true